The first instance in America where a lady officiated as clergyman at a wedding ceremony was at Columbus, Ohio, > few weeks ago, wh'on .Mm LydiajG. Romic, tho evangelist,, perPim, of Damascus, Ohio,: and Miss' Emma Bryant. Both bride and bride; groom are members of the Society of Friends.

Children under 12' years of age in; Rtiseitf-ltfe' prohibited by. Jaw from being employed in, factories uhdei' anjP pretence whatever,' while ' from the ages from 12 to 15 they must./not, :be allowed to work more than eight hours a,day. ;In the latter case, moreover,th.ey must attend school at least three hours a'day, •- —"
